While installing tiff-3.8.2, I got the following error: creating libtiffxx.la (cd .libs && rm -f libtiffxx.la && ln -s ../libtiffxx.la libtiffxx.la) /usr/bin/install -c .libs/libtiffxx.so.3.8T /usr/local/lib/libtiffxx.so.3.8 install: .libs/libtiffxx.so.3.8T: stat: No such file or directory *** Error code 1
The libraries were built and named corectly (libtiffxx.so.3.8.2), but somehow an extraneous "T" replaces the subversion number in the install process. I have tried both the latest GNU make and native NetBSD3.0 make. The error occurs with either version of libtool: ltmain.sh (GNU libtool 1.2248 2006/01/21 17:40:19) 2.1a or ltmain.sh (GNU libtool) 1.5.22 (1.1220.2.365 2005/12/18 22:14:06). The exact same error, "T: stat: No such file or directory", has been reported by others in an earlier version of tiff: http://mail-index.netbsd.org/tech-pkg/2005/12/17/0016.html and in another application: http://article.gmane.org/gmane.comp.video.graphicsmagick.core/273 I'm not at all sure this is even a libtool problem.
